Jim Dimanis currently serves as the Chair of the Office of the Employer Adviser (OEA) at the Bureau Du Conseiller Des Employeurs, where he leverages his extensive experience in real estate and strategic advisory roles to enhance the support provided to Ontario employers. In this pivotal position, Jim is instrumental in guiding employers through the complexities of workers' compensation issues and unjust reprisal claims, ensuring they receive expert, confidential advice tailored to their unique circumstances. His leadership is characterized by a commitment to fostering a collaborative environment where employers can thrive, particularly in navigating the intricacies of the Workplace Safety and Insurance Act and the Occupational Health and Safety Act.
